Duh-nuh-nuh-nuh they said it’s her birth-tay! Yep. Our daughter L finally turned five. When I asked what theme she wanted it was immediate. “Taylor Swift!” She’s been obsessed since I took her and her brother to their first movie theater outing to see the Eras Tour Movie, so it made for a fitting choice.

So what would that mean for five-year-olds?! In the end, we decided on a unicorn craft themed party with all Taylor Swift music, which ended up being the perfect combo. If you are looking for a good playlist of more kid-friendly (or at least I’d say Logan-approved), I’m embedding mine here.

Venue

I had heard a lot of great things about Zumbini with Allie after Q went to a birthday party there recently. I took a look at their website and saw they had a Taylor Swift dance party but for older kids. They did have a unicorn craft so we decided perhaps a bit of both worlds for her party!

Zumbini with Allie open play space

The owner was amazing in working with us to do a custom setup — with the kids doing a unicorn craft and listening to an all-Taylor Swift soundtrack as they enjoyed open play between activities and food rounds.

The venue took care of pizza, plates and utensils for the kids and we were allowed to bring in our own cake. We needed to bring in our own plates and silverware for the dessert, and all of the above for parents for both pizza and dessert.

Cake

Speaking of cake, it’s always a top priority to me when planning any birthday celebrations. As always, we went with a cake from Natale’s Bakery in Summit. We went with streamer icing decorations and added a cardboard decoration on top and voila! All set.

Decorations

We totally lucked out in that one of my coworkers who got VIP passes to the Eras Tour gave us some of the gorgeous posters and postcards to add a bit of authentic Taylor decor to the mix!

The party room was a decent size and we put up a metallic fringe backdrop layered with a Taylor Swift sign hanging across. The two really worked to brighten it up and make for a perfect backdrop.

Party favors

Taylor Swift themed bracelets

These were a MUST in the swag bags. We got this set from Amazon. There was one small misspelling but these were still great quality and value. They were such a hit!


Taylor Swift stickers

These were relatively inexpensive for 151 stickers! These aren’t the exact set we got (we’ve found so many of the things you find on Amazon get taken down) but they look almost the same.


Heart-shaped sunglasses

These were a must-buy. We went with this option based on speed of delivery but there were also some fun multi-colored ones.

Shimmery polka-dot bags

There were more Taylor Swift options but we went with these which added a bit of shimmer but didn’t overpower. Couldn’t beat the price point!

Overall, it was such a wonderful celebration and our little Swiftie had the best special day.
